The QS-9000 certification was awarded to Bayer as the result of an in-depth audit of its complete quality system -- including an investigation of its manufacturing process, strategic business planning and customer satisfaction. With this announcement, Bayer becomes the first -- and only -- synthetic rubber company worldwide to receive QS-9000 certification.

Bayer Inc., the Canadian subsidiary of the international chemical and health care company Bayer AG (Germany), is research-based with major businesses in health care, chemicals, and imaging technologies. Headquartered in Toronto, with a major synthetic rubber manufacturing site in Sarnia, Bayer Inc. employs more than 2,300 people. Sales in 1997 exceeded $1.3 billion.

Bayer Corporation is a research-based company with major businesses in health care and life sciences, chemicals and imaging technologies. The company had 1997 sales of $9.3 billion and employs more than 24,000 people. Bayer Corporation is investing $9 billion in capital expenditures and research and development from 1995 through the year 2000. 1998 capital investment and R&D expenditures are projected to total $1.7 billion. Bayer Corporation, with headquarters in Pittsburgh, is a member of the worldwide Bayer Group, a $32 billion chemical and pharmaceutical company based in Leverkusen, Germany.
